Output 38ab993bdaa3e422831358fa12cafa38e56e1128248a22078095fafa8e44a51d:0

value
10699808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3c8dcdbb0050ee5ab600de9741b007845648fae OP_EQUALVERIFY OP_CHECKSIG
address
1MmR1jUzBegyYLGyaD2u9MPoWNeUY4hriD
transaction
38ab993bdaa3e422831358fa12cafa38e56e1128248a22078095fafa8e44a51d
confirmations
535336
spent
true